Here's a glimpse at his Wigan transfer history that will hopefully calm some folks down:
In a four year period he made the following signings:
09/10: Diame, McCarthy (1m rising to 5m), V Moses 2.5m, J Gomez 1.7m he also sold cattermole for 6m and l.a. valencia for 16m
10/11: DiSanto 2m, J McArthur, Boselli 6.5m, Alcaraz Free
11/12: Al Habsi 4m, Maloney 1m, Beausejour 3m he also sold nzogbia for 9.5m
12/13: I Ramis 5m, A Kone 2.7m, Espinoza free he also sold v moses for 9m
Last year he bought McCarthy for 13m and most went crazy. By December that looked like an invaluable addition at a great price.
Boselli is the only huge miss, which for a club like wigan is a big statement. I realize those players are not great players but they kept wigan in the premier league for 3-4 more years than they should have been.
